the dividers can be open between most balconies.....but there is an issue with some of the dividers and how they block balcony access from one of the cabins when properly secured to the bulkhead by Carnival. I say this because some folks do this on their own and don't always secure the door resulting in constant slamming due to winds and a ship moving at 20 knots.

 

We had this very issue years ago which is why I made this to try and explain. I think your two cabins will have this issue

Our secured divider blocked access from my SIL's cabin...the kids were in her cabin so after multiple discussions with the desk...they removed the divider completely allowing us all to have access.
